    <title>Delay in filing GSTR-3B returns found to involve duplicate proceedings causing double taxation; impugned demand quashed.</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/highlights?id=96341</link>
    <description>Two distinct authorities issued separate demands and penalties for delayed filing of GSTR-3B returns for the same period, resulting in duplication of proceedings and double taxation; the impugned administrative action was held unsustainable and consequently quashed, with the writ petition allowed. The legal points focus on duplication of proceedings as a bar to multiple demands for the same tax period, the resultant double taxation, liability for interest and penalty arising from delayed GSTR-3B filings, and the availability of writ relief to challenge overlapping tax proceedings.</description>
